Best Value Apartments for Rent in Vinewood Beach, OH

As of July 08, 2026 the best value apartment in the Vinewood Beach area is the $1.13 price per square foot A3 Model at Parker Place in the in the Brentwood neighborhood starting from $1,438. The second greatest value Vinewood Beach apartment is the C2-R w/ Den Model at Willogrove Apartments starting at $1,329 with a $1.29 price per square foot in the Brentwood neighborhood. Here is today’s list of the best values for Vinewood Beach apartments based on price per square foot:

Frequently Asked Questions about Vinewood Beach

What type of rentals are currently available in Vinewood Beach?

There are currently 60 Apartments for Rent in Vinewood Beach, OH with pricing that ranges from $660 to $1,845. There are also 3 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Vinewood Beach ranging from $1,375 to $1,550.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Vinewood Beach?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Vinewood Beach ranges from $1,375 to $1,550 with an average monthly rent of $1,454.
